pub struct TimeWindowSpan {
pub start: Timestamp,
pub end: Timestamp,
}
Expand description
A time window declared by its start and end timestamp.
Fields§
§start: Timestamp
The inclusive start timestamp of the span.
end: Timestamp
The exclusive end timestamp of the span.
Implementations§
Trait Implementations§
source§impl Clone for TimeWindowSpan
impl Clone for TimeWindowSpan
source§fn clone(&self) -> TimeWindowSpan
fn clone(&self) -> TimeWindowSpan
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for TimeWindowSpan
impl Debug for TimeWindowSpan
impl Copy for TimeWindowSpan
Auto Trait Implementations§
impl Freeze for TimeWindowSpan
impl RefUnwindSafe for TimeWindowSpan
impl Send for TimeWindowSpan
impl Sync for TimeWindowSpan
impl Unpin for TimeWindowSpan
impl UnwindSafe for TimeWindowSpan
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more